How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Algonquin?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Algonquin Studio Apartments | $924 | $200 | $1,443 |
Algonquin 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,154 | $200 | $3,132 |
Algonquin 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,319 | $699 | $4,490 |
Algonquin 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,464 | $599 | $6,880 |
Algonquin 4 Bedroom Apartments | $535 | $535 | $535 |

Getting Around the Algonquin Neighborhood in Louisville, KY
Walk Score®
53 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
53 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
43 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
